IF OUR BODIES RECEIVE KARMIC RETRIBUTIONS, HOW CAN WE MAKE SURE THAT OUR MINDS ARE NOT TO BE MANIPULATED BY THE EVIL FRUITS?

Wenda20161216  26:30
(Master Jun Hong Lu’s call-in radio program)

Caller:  When one comes across “369” predetermined calamity, the “little black dots” on his/her body will erupt as sudden bad luck, and bad affinities and bad consequences will cause a kind and happy person to suffer from intense pain and misfortunes. Is it true that one is the most vulnerable when karmic obstacles erupt, giving rise to opportunities for evil thoughts to penetrate? One may fall into a trap causing new negative karmic debts; he/she is not only unable to eliminate the karmic debts but keeps multiplying them cyclically, losing in reincarnation finally.  If our bodies receive negative karmic retributions, how can we make sure that our minds not to be controlled and manipulated by the evil karmic fruits?

Master Jun Hong Lu:  This will depend on your level of cultivation.  You will be able to resolve your problems when your cultivation reaches a certain level, for example, a Bodhisattva’s realm.  Why is that?  Because you have already attained a very spiritual level; You don’t have any unwholesome words and thoughts residing in your mind. You’re perfectly calm and peaceful in mind. In that way, how could any negative karmic consequences befall upon you?


Caller:  I understand.  When negative karma surfaced, non-Buddhist practitioners will complain and feel resentful. But for practitioners who have cultivated for some years and read Master Lu’s “Buddhism In Plain Terms”, they are more likely to get over such situations -  because Master Lu has repeatedly taught us to treat bad situations as imperminment and pay back debts.  The debts have been paid off and the karma removed. What we need to do is forget the past and stop creating new karma. This question is raised while I read your book: ‘Buddhism In Plain Terms’.
